Abstract

This utility model provides a kind of elastic displacement device and the board-like retractor device of comb, belongs to highway bridge auxiliary equipment technical field, it is possible to reflect the pressure that elastic displacement device bears in real time.This elasticity displacement device, including at least two-layer high-damping rubber plate, and is arranged on the high-damping rubber frame between two-layer high-damping rubber plate;Being fixed with strain steel disc in described high-damping rubber frame, the side of described strain steel disc is pasted with optical fiber sensing element.

Background technology
The retractor device that the board-like retractor device of comb deforms as a kind of bridge superstructure, because it is easy for installation, structure The advantages such as simply, cost is low have obtained the extensive application of science of bridge building circle.The board-like retractor device of common comb is mainly by across seam Fishback unit and fixed fingers Slab element composition, can be at suitable bridge to aspect generation telescopic displacement.But owing to heavy vehicle travels During the effect of brake force, bigger to periphery concrete destruction across the power effect that is hit of seam fishback unit.Further, due to weight Type vehicle travels reasons such as bringing to a halt to the board-like retractor device of comb, the volume of traffic is big, often occurs that connecting bolt destroys existing As.In the course of time, the shortcomings such as the impact resistance of the board-like retractor device of common comb is weak, connecting bolt destructible can expose Come so that it is occur in that certain limitation when application.
In the patent documentation of Application No. CN201420517470.0, disclose a kind of bridge with buffering energy-consumption function The board-like retractor device of beam comb.This board-like retractor device of bridge comb is by across seam fishback unit, fixed fingers Slab element, elasticity Displacement device, L-type connecting bolt and waterstop composition, the board-like retractor device of bridge comb is across being arranged between the beam of the left and right sides In gap, fixed fingers Slab element is connected, across stitching fishback through cast-in-situ concrete beam face is fixing by L-type connecting bolt and right side beam Unit is affixed through cast-in-situ concrete beam face with left side beam by L-type connecting bolt, across seam fishback unit and fixed fingers plate list The comb correspondence interfix of unit.Elastic displacement device is coupled across the lower surface of seam fishback unit by L-type connecting bolt, with across The cast-in-situ concrete beam face of seam fishback unit one curb girder is affixed.When bridge causes flexible because of variations in temperature, owing to elasticity becomes The high-damping rubber of position device has the performance of damping energy dissipation so that elastic displacement device can bear the impact of motor vehicles repeatedly Power, has good cushioning effect, improves the impact resistance of bridge, and protects the L-type of the board-like retractor device of comb to connect Bolt is difficult to impaired, extends its service life.
Elastic displacement device is when stress, although can effectively prevent the contingent bending failure of L-type connecting bolt, But it is the elastomeric element that main material is made by high-damping rubber after all, and it is after being rolled by vehicle for a long time, can produce Permanent deformation.And when the deformation quantity of elastic displacement device is excessive, it just loses effect to the protection of L-type connecting bolt. Therefore, the key factor during elastic displacement device is bridge inspection and maintenance.

Embodiment one:
This utility model embodiment provides a kind of elastic displacement device, including at least two-layer high-damping rubber plate, and It is arranged on the high-damping rubber frame between two-layer high-damping rubber plate.
In the present embodiment, elastic displacement device includes two-layer high-damping rubber plate, and two-layered steel plates.As it is shown in figure 1, it is high Be cascading above damping rubber frame 31 first high-damping rubber plate 321 and the first steel plate 331, high-damping from the bottom to top From top to bottom be cascading below rubber frame 31 second high-damping rubber plate 322 and the second steel plate 332.
Being fixed with strain steel disc 34 in high-damping rubber frame 31, the side of strain steel disc 34 is pasted with optical fiber sensing element 35.Optical fiber sensing element 35 itself is difficult to explosion, is not affected by temperature and humidity extreme value and is not the most affected by electrical noise, optical fiber Sensitive first 35 volumes are little and have the ability passing light along crooked route, therefore may be used for the place being difficult to measure.Due to greatly Most optical fiber sensing elements are passive, so reliability is the highest, it is possible to solve the measurement problem of a lot of traditional industry.
As a preferred version, optical fiber sensing element 35 specifically can use FBG strain gauge.Fiber grating should Becoming sheet is a kind of novel optical fiber optical grating stress sensing precast construction, and it is encapsulated in inside optical connector Bragg grating with reality Existing Split socket type structure, thus ensure FBG strain gauge while there is the advantages such as Bragg grating small and light, Also there is the ease of use being similar to optical connector, thus solve original optical fiber optical grating stress sensor and use complexity, The defect of quadratic transformation element should not be used as, expand the range of optical fiber optical grating stress sensor.FBG strain gauge There is good linear convergent rate and measure sensitivity, and thermal output is little, is the general of a kind of applicable engineering test librarian use Type optical fiber optical grating stress sensor.
Further, the side of the high-damping rubber frame 31 in the present embodiment offers perforation 310, for by with light The optical fiber that fine sensing element 35 connects, the optical signal making optical fiber sensing element 35 send can be transmitted through the fiber to outside.
The elastic displacement device that this utility model embodiment provides, including two-layer high-damping rubber plate 321,322 and two-layer Steel plate 331,332, and it is arranged on the high-damping rubber frame 31 between two-layer high-damping rubber plate 321,322, high-damping rubber Frame 31 is fixed with strain steel disc 34, and the side straining steel disc 34 is pasted with optical fiber sensing element 35.When strain steel disc 34 After entirety deforms upon, the optical fiber sensing element 35 that its strain face is fixed can occur adaptive deformation equally, and then affects light The wavelength of the light of fine sensing element 35 output.
When the elastic displacement device that this utility model embodiment provides is rolled, by vehicle, the pressure caused, optical fiber is sensitive Strain steel disc 34 can be converted into optical signal because of the deformation occurred that is stressed by element 35.Staff believes by detecting this light Number, it is possible to learn elastic displacement device pressure experienced.Therefore, in this utility model embodiment, by strain steel disc 34 Side optical fiber sensing element 35 is set, it is possible to reflect the pressure that elastic displacement device bears in real time, and by staff institute Learn, to avoid elastic displacement device generation permanent deformation, thus improve the safety of the board-like retractor device of comb.
Embodiment two:
As in figure 2 it is shown, this utility model embodiment also provides for a kind of board-like retractor device of comb, including across seam fishback list Unit 1, fixed fingers Slab element 2 and above-mentioned elastic displacement device 3.
This board-like retractor device of bridge comb is in the clearance C being arranged on left and right sides beam, i.e. across seam fishback unit 1 It is connected on the left and right sides beam A, B with fixed fingers Slab element 2.Wherein, spiral shell is connected across seam fishback unit 1 by L-type Bolt 4 and left side beam A are affixed through cast-in-situ concrete beam face A-1, and fixed fingers Slab element 2 is by L-type connecting bolt 4 and right side beam B Through the fixing connection of cast-in-situ concrete beam face B-1, across seam fishback unit 1 interfix corresponding with the comb of fixed fingers Slab element 2.Separately Outward, the avris of left side beam A is also welded with block D.
Elastic displacement device 3 is arranged on the lower surface across seam fishback unit 1, is to connect spiral shell by L-type in the present embodiment Bolt 4 is coupled across stitching fishback unit 1 lower surface, affixed with the cast-in-situ concrete beam face A-1 of left side beam A.
Additionally, the board-like retractor device of this comb also includes the waterstop 5 being arranged between the left and right sides beam A, B, waterstop 5 It is connected in the clearance C of left and right sides beam A, B, and in the mounting groove of press-in beam body.
As it is shown on figure 3, in the board-like retractor device of comb of this utility model embodiment offer, also include and optical fiber sensitivity unit The photoelectricity decoder 61 that part 35 connects, the optical signal that optical fiber sensing element 35 exports is converted to the signal of telecommunication by photoelectricity decoder 61.
Photoelectricity decoder 61 is the device that one converts optical signals to digital signal (signal of telecommunication).By photoelectricity decoder 61 carry out opto-electronic conversion, and the optical signal that optical fiber sensing element 35 exports is converted to the signal of telecommunication, are more convenient for adopting this signal Collection and identification.
As a preferred version, optical fiber sensing element 35 is connected to photoelectricity decoder 61, and optical fiber 60 by optical fiber 60 Path through waterstop 5.Utilize waterstop 5 as connecting the path of optical fiber 60 of optical fiber sensing element 35, can save into Optical fiber 60 separately sets the operation in path, it is simple to the enforcement of the board-like retractor device of comb.
Further, in the board-like retractor device of comb that this utility model embodiment provides, also include decoding with photoelectricity The digital instrument 62 that device 61 connects, digital instrument 62 can measure the signal of telecommunication of photoelectricity decoder 61 output.
Digital instrument 62 is that measurement is converted into digital quantity, and the instrument shown in digital form.In commercial measurement The analog quantitys such as middle measured variable or displacement, electric current, voltage, air pressure, through analog-digital converter, change digital quantity into simulation amount.Number Word instrument 62 can show measured in digital form, and reading is directly perceived.
Reading is directly perceived, convenient, do not have the advantages such as the collimation error owing to possessing for digital instrument, thus development is quickly, in recent years More develop into and can be connected with other actuators (such as printer, facsimile machine), it is also possible to output switch amount or analog quantity, be used for Connection control system or computer.It addition, also some numeral electrical instrument possesses the central processing unit (CPU) of oneself and various deposits Reservoir, so some numeral electrical instrument Microcomputer, intellectuality.Certainly, the present embodiment uses relatively common numeral Instrument.
Because the signal of telecommunication of photoelectricity decoder 61 output itself belongs to digital signal, so it is right to be wholly adapted to digital instrument 62 It measures and shows, thus utilizes digital instrument 62 to achieve the quantization to strain steel plate 34 pressure and measure with aobvious Show.
Further, in the board-like retractor device of comb that this utility model embodiment provides, also include and digital instrument 62 computers 63 connected, computer 63 can carry out numerical monitor to the measurement result of digital instrument 62.
Additionally, computer 63 can also be according to the measurement result of digital instrument 62, the stressing conditions to elastic displacement device 3 It is analyzed, and exports analysis result, enable staff to understand the stressing conditions of elastic displacement device 3 more accurately.
As a preferred version, above-mentioned photoelectricity decoder 61, digital instrument 62 and computer 63, all may be provided at friendship In logical caretaker room or room security, in order to staff can intuitively and easily understand the real-time stress of elastic displacement device 3 Situation, and judge whether the board-like retractor device of comb exists potential safety hazard.
The board-like retractor device of comb that this utility model embodiment provides, have employed the elasticity provided in above-described embodiment one Displacement device 3.After strain steel disc 34 entirety in elastic displacement device 3 deforms upon, the optical fiber sensitivity that its strain face is fixing Element 35 can occur adaptive deformation equally, and then affects the wavelength of the light of optical fiber sensing element 35 output.
The board-like retractor device of comb that this utility model embodiment provides in use, when elastic displacement device 3 is subject to To vehicle roll the pressure caused time, optical fiber sensing element 35 can by strain steel disc 34 because of be stressed occur deformation be converted into Optical signal, and by photoelectricity decoder 61, this optical signal is converted to the signal of telecommunication.Then, this signal of telecommunication is surveyed by digital instrument 62 Amount and display, computer 63 can also be further according to the measurement result of digital instrument 62, the stress feelings to elastic displacement device 3 Condition is analyzed.
Optical fiber sensing element 35 output optical signal, after changing, measure, show, analyzing, be positioned at traffic administration room or Staff in room security, it is possible to understand the stressing conditions of elastic displacement device 3 accurately.Therefore, this utility model is real Execute in example, by using the elastic displacement device 3 provided in above-described embodiment one, it is possible to reflect elastic displacement device 3 in real time Stressing conditions, and learnt by staff, to avoid elastic displacement device 3 that permanent deformation occurs, thus improve comb The safety of toothed plate type retractor device.
